Choosing between the Ford Mustang and the Mercedes-Benz Sl Class is one of the most common decisions car buyers in the United States face. The Ford Mustang delivers 480hp @ 7150 while the Mercedes-Benz Sl Class produces 577hp @ 5500. Pricing starts at $56,580 for the Mustang and $112,550 for the Sl Class.
